What to know today 'PRO-HUMAN' AI CONFERENCE: Sen. Bernie Sanders, I-Vt., and former Trump White House aide Steve Bannon will be among the attendees at a conference in Washington, D.C., today, dubbed the Pro-Human Assembly, aimed at pressing for new policies to place some curbs on the rapidly accelerating development of artificial intelligence. TRUMP DOWNPLAYS CONCERNS: President Donald Trump, meanwhile, has characterized concerns about AI safety as a "hoax," saying in a phone call to Nvidia's Jensen Huang, which the CEO put on speakerphone at an industry summit, that the U.S. had to beat China in AI innovation and development. ECONOMIC IMPACT: The calls from tech executives and world leaders to put some brakes on AI development are raising questions about whether a tech slowdown could rein in U.S. economic growth.
